[arch-general] [arch-dev-public] List of packages that could be rebuilt if you have nothing better to do...

Gerardo Exequiel Pozzi vmlinuz386 at yahoo.com.ar
Mon Oct 19 22:06:56 EDT 2009


Gerardo Exequiel Pozzi wrote:
> Allan McRae wrote:
>   
>> Gerardo Exequiel Pozzi wrote:
>>     
>>> Allan McRae wrote:
>>>  
>>>       
>>>> Hi,
>>>>
>>>> I have created a list of packages the could use a rebuild but for
>>>> which there is no hurry.  These include packages without the arch in
>>>> their filename, packages containing a .FILELIST file, packages with
>>>> man pages in /usr/man or uncompress man and info pages.  See
>>>> http://wiki.archlinux.org/index.php/User:Allan/Unimportant_Rebuild_List
>>>>
>>>> Do people think this is useful and should I move it to the
>>>> DeveloperWiki?
>>>>
>>>> Allan
>>>>
>>>>     
>>>>         
>>> Good job.
>>>
>>> And for "Packages that can be converted to arch=any" sometime ago I
>>> sended a list of tentative packages [#1]. Its old and some of listed
>>> packages [#2] are now "any"
>>>
>>>
>>> [#1]
>>> http://mailman.archlinux.org/pipermail/aur-general/2009-July/005960.html
>>> [#2] http://archlinux.djgera.com.ar/misc/any.txt
>>>   
>>>       
>> I'm being lazy...   any change you can easily generate an updated list
>> for [core]/[extra]?  Don't worry about it if it will be a hassle.
>>
>> Allan
>>
>>
>>
>>     
> No problem, I can do a "light scan" making a difference between this
> list and list of current packages.
> I guess that doing again a "deep scan" don't make much sense,
>
>
> Good Luck!
>
>   
List updated [#1]

This is based on old list, deleting current converted packages and
packages deleted from repos.
No new packages are added because I didn't a deep/fine scan. For each repo.

If any have a time, the idea to do the deep scan is (what I remember was
done manually in the past)

1) Download this db [#2].
2) Keep with 0 size files from db. -> packages names.
3) Scan from previous result list if there are any ELF32/ELF64 LSB
(relocatables (objects files, kernel modules, ar archives, etc),
executables, shared objects) and discard ELF for others archs (for
example AVR, ARM, SPARC) inside each package.


[#1] http://archlinux.djgera.com.ar/misc/any-20091019.txt
[#2] http://archlinux.djgera.com.ar/pkgdyn/db-20091019.tar.bz2

-- 
Gerardo Exequiel Pozzi ( djgera )
http://www.djgera.com.ar
KeyID: 0x1B8C330D
Key fingerprint = 0CAA D5D4 CD85 4434 A219  76ED 39AB 221B 1B8C 330D



More information about the arch-general mailing list